Annual Recertification Requirements

To maintain your CKYCA certification in good standing, you must meet specific requirements each year. The primary requirement is earning a minimum of 2 ACAMS recertification credits within your certification year. These credits must be earned through approved continuing education activities that directly relate to AML, KYC, or financial crime prevention topics.

Credit Requirements and Sources

The 2-credit annual requirement can be fulfilled through various ACAMS-approved activities. Credits are typically earned in 1-credit increments, making the requirement straightforward to meet. Common credit sources include attending ACAMS webinars, participating in chapter meetings, completing online training modules, attending conferences, and engaging in approved self-study programs.

Credits must be relevant to AML, KYC, sanctions, or related financial crime prevention topics. ACAMS maintains strict standards for credit approval, ensuring that all qualifying activities contribute meaningfully to professional development. The organization regularly updates its list of approved activities to reflect current industry needs and educational opportunities.

Credit SourceCredit ValueTime CommitmentCost
ACAMS Webinar1 Credit1 HourFree (Members)
Chapter Meeting1 Credit1-2 HoursFree
Online Module1 Credit1-2 HoursVaries
Conference Session1 Credit1 HourConference Fee

Recertification Costs & Fees

One of the most attractive aspects of CKYCA recertification is its cost structure. For ACAMS members who meet the credit requirements, recertification is completely free. This no-cost approach eliminates financial barriers to maintaining certification and encourages continuous professional development throughout your career.

Free Recertification Benefit

CKYCA recertification costs $0 for active ACAMS members who complete their 2 required credits. This makes it one of the most cost-effective certification maintenance programs in financial services.

2027 Recertification Timeline

The 2027 recertification cycle follows ACAMS' established annual timeline, with specific deadlines based on your initial certification date. Understanding these timelines is crucial for avoiding lapses in certification status and ensuring continuous professional standing.

Individual Certification Anniversaries

Your recertification deadline corresponds to your original certification anniversary date. If you earned your CKYCA in March 2026, your 2027 recertification will be due in March 2027. ACAMS provides multiple notifications leading up to your deadline, typically beginning 90 days before expiration.

Grace Periods and Extensions

ACAMS typically provides a brief grace period after the official recertification deadline, though specific terms may vary. During this grace period, your certification remains valid while you complete outstanding requirements. However, relying on grace periods isn't recommended, as it may complicate professional activities that require current certification status.

In exceptional circumstances, ACAMS may consider extension requests for recertification deadlines. These are typically granted only for documented hardships such as medical emergencies or military deployment. Extension requests should be submitted well before the deadline with appropriate supporting documentation.

Non-Compliance Consequences

Failing to meet recertification requirements has serious implications for your professional standing and career prospects. Understanding these consequences helps motivate timely compliance and proper planning for certification maintenance.

Certification Lapse Process

When you fail to complete recertification requirements by the deadline, your CKYCA status changes from "Active" to "Lapsed." This status change is reflected in ACAMS' certification verification system, making it visible to employers, clients, and professional contacts who verify your credentials.

During the lapse period, you cannot legally claim to hold current CKYCA certification. This restriction affects professional communications, resume accuracy, and compliance with employer certification requirements. Many organizations require active certification status for continued employment in certain roles.

Frequently Asked Questions

What happens if I earn more than 2 credits in a certification year?

Excess credits do not carry over to the following certification year. However, earning additional credits demonstrates commitment to professional development and provides insurance against last-minute complications with planned credit activities.

Can I complete recertification requirements before my anniversary date?

Yes, you can earn and submit recertification credits at any time during your certification year. ACAMS encourages early completion to avoid last-minute complications and ensure continuous certification status.

Are there any exemptions from the annual recertification requirement?

ACAMS does not provide standard exemptions from recertification requirements. All active CKYCA holders must complete annual requirements to maintain certification status, regardless of experience level or current employment status.

How do I verify my current certification status and credit balance?

Log into your ACAMS member portal to view real-time certification status, credit balance, and upcoming deadlines. This system provides comprehensive tracking of all certification-related activities and requirements.
